15 Stunning Black Sofa Living Room Decor Ideas
1. Pair with Light, Neutral Tones

When decorating with a black sofa, balance is key. Pair it with light, neutral colors like beige, white, or light gray to keep the space feeling open and airy. This contrast helps the black sofa pop without making the room feel too dark. Consider using neutral-toned walls or rugs to create a calm and inviting atmosphere. You can also add natural wooden furniture to soften the look and introduce warmth into the space.
The combination of black and light shades creates a timeless, sophisticated look that works in both modern and traditional settings. By keeping the color scheme simple and clean, you’ll make sure your black sofa remains the centerpiece while still allowing other design elements to shine.
2. Incorporate Pops of Color with Throw Pillows

One of the easiest ways to bring life to a black sofa is by using colorful throw pillows. Bold reds, deep blues, or vibrant yellows can add personality to the space without overwhelming the design. Choose pillows in varying textures and patterns to add dimension and interest. This approach lets you experiment with different colors without committing to a full room makeover.
Don’t be afraid to mix and match—stripes, geometric patterns, or florals can all work beautifully against a black backdrop. The best part? You can easily swap out pillows to change the vibe of your living room whenever you want, offering endless possibilities.
3. Add a Touch of Luxury with Metallic Accents

Metallic accents can add a layer of elegance to a black sofa, making the room feel more sophisticated and stylish. Think gold, silver, or bronze accessories like lamps, coffee tables, or picture frames. These reflective surfaces contrast beautifully with the deep black of the sofa, creating a dynamic balance between bold and subtle.
A few well-placed metallic pieces will elevate your decor, adding warmth and shine without taking away from the sleekness of the black sofa. Whether you choose small touches like candle holders or larger statement pieces, metallics can create a luxurious, modern atmosphere.
4. Incorporate Natural Elements

Bring a fresh, earthy vibe to your living room by adding natural elements such as plants, wooden furniture, or stone accents. Greenery is especially striking against a black sofa, as the vibrant green color creates a stunning contrast. You can place a few plants around the room or even use large potted plants near the sofa for a more dramatic effect.
Wooden coffee tables or bookshelves complement a black sofa by adding warmth to the space. These natural elements help balance out the sharpness of the black color and create a cozy, inviting room.
5. Go Bold with a Statement Rug

A statement rug can tie the entire room together while adding visual interest. Look for rugs with bold patterns, rich colors, or even texture that contrast against the black sofa. A rug can also define the seating area and help break up the space, especially in large or open-plan rooms.
If your living room feels too dark, a bright or patterned rug can instantly lighten up the area, giving it a vibrant, welcoming feel. Choose something that complements your other decor and brings out the best in your black sofa.
6. Play with Textures to Create Depth

Black sofas can sometimes appear flat if the room lacks texture, so mix and match different materials to add depth and warmth to your living room. Consider incorporating velvet cushions, woven throws, or a shaggy rug. The contrast between the sleek black sofa and textured accents will give the room a layered, inviting look.
Textures like faux fur or leather also add a touch of luxury and sophistication. You can even introduce various finishes on furniture—matte wood, glossy metal, or matte ceramics—to create a balanced and visually engaging space.

7. Pair with a Light-Colored Coffee Table

A coffee table in a light color—whether wood, glass, or marble—can be the perfect complement to a black sofa. The contrast between the dark and light tones makes the room feel balanced and visually appealing. This simple yet effective idea can create a focal point without overwhelming the space.
Glass tables are especially useful as they keep the room feeling open and spacious. They let the beauty of the black sofa stand out while adding an element of elegance and airiness to the decor.
8. Add a Pop of Artwork

A large piece of art or a gallery wall can give the room character and personality. Choose artwork that uses bright colors or bold designs to break up the solid black of the sofa. Abstract art, nature prints, or even black-and-white photography work well with the bold color of the sofa.
By carefully selecting pieces that reflect your style, you can use art to set the mood and tone of the room. A well-placed piece of art not only adds interest but also elevates the overall design of the space.
9. Try a Black-and-White Theme

For those who love a minimalist style, a black-and-white theme can be striking and timeless. Incorporating white walls, furniture, and decor will allow the black sofa to stand out as the focal point. This high-contrast design creates a clean, modern, and sophisticated atmosphere that works well in both small and large rooms.
This simple color palette also gives you the flexibility to change your decor with ease. A few swaps in pillows, art, or textiles can bring in seasonal changes or freshen up the room whenever you desire.

10. Create a Cozy Atmosphere with Soft Lighting

Lighting plays a crucial role in how your black sofa is perceived in the room. Soft, warm lighting from floor lamps, table lamps, or wall sconces can create a cozy, welcoming environment. Avoid harsh overhead lighting, which may make the room feel too stark.
Consider using dimmable lights to adjust the ambiance as needed, whether you’re hosting guests or enjoying a quiet evening. The right lighting can soften the black sofa’s impact and make the entire room feel inviting.
11. Opt for a Monochrome Look

If you love a cohesive, streamlined look, a monochrome color scheme can work beautifully with a black sofa. Use varying shades of black, gray, and white throughout the room to create a sophisticated and sleek design. This minimalist approach lets your black sofa shine while keeping the room elegant and clean.
To add variety, mix in different textures, such as a black leather chair or a soft gray wool throw. The key is to create subtle contrasts through materials, rather than colors, to maintain interest in the space.
12. Combine with Mid-Century Modern Furniture

For a chic, retro vibe, pair your black sofa with mid-century modern furniture. Think clean lines, wooden legs, and simple, functional design. A mid-century modern coffee table, side chairs, or accent pieces can bring out the sleekness of the black sofa while maintaining a relaxed yet stylish atmosphere.
This combination works well in contemporary homes that want to mix bold colors with timeless design. You can even add colorful cushions or rugs to brighten up the space.

13. Use Contrasting Fabrics

Mixing contrasting fabrics like linen and velvet or leather and wool can add richness and depth to your living room. These textures can soften the boldness of a black sofa while also adding visual interest. For instance, you might pair your black sofa with soft linen curtains and velvet cushions to create a mix of luxurious and natural elements.
Using a variety of fabrics will also make your space feel more personalized and cozy, especially during the colder months when texture is key to making the room feel inviting.
14. Incorporate Vintage Decor

Vintage decor pieces can add charm and character to a living room with a black sofa. Whether it’s a retro lamp, a patterned rug, or an antique side table, vintage items introduce personality into the space. They offer a great contrast to the modern look of a black sofa, making the room feel more eclectic and curated.
By blending contemporary and vintage styles, you can create a dynamic and inviting atmosphere that feels both unique and timeless.
15. Use Mirrors to Reflect Light

Mirrors are a great way to open up a room and make it feel bigger and brighter, especially when paired with a black sofa. A large mirror or a set of smaller mirrors can reflect natural light, making your space feel airier and less enclosed. They also create a sense of depth and can visually balance out the darker elements in the room.
Mirrors also add a touch of glamour and sophistication, enhancing the room’s overall aesthetic without overshadowing the black sofa.
